// baseURLAttemptOrder returns the ordered upstream base URLs to try for a single
|
||||
// request, drawn from the remote's pool ([base_url] + mirrorlist). A multi-mirror
|
||||
// remote starts at the next round-robin position and advances linearly for
|
||||
// failover; a remote with no mirrorlist yields exactly [base_url], preserving the
|
||||
// original single-attempt behavior.
|
||||
func (e *Engine) baseURLAttemptOrder(remote models.Remote) []string {
|
||||
urls := remote.UpstreamPool()
|
||||
if len(urls) <= 1 {
|
||||
return urls
|
||||
}
|
||||
v, _ := e.rrCounters.LoadOrStore(remote.Name, new(atomic.Uint64))
|
||||
start := int(v.(*atomic.Uint64).Add(1) - 1)
|
||||
ordered := make([]string, len(urls))
|
||||
for i := range urls {
|
||||
ordered[i] = urls[(start+i)%len(urls)]
|
||||
}
|
||||
return ordered
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// withBaseURL narrows a remote's active BaseURL to a single selected mirror so
|
||||
// providers (UpstreamURL/AuthHeaders/RewriteResponse) operate on exactly that
|
||||
// upstream for this attempt.
|
||||
func withBaseURL(remote models.Remote, url string) models.Remote {
|
||||
remote.BaseURL = url
|
||||
remote.Mirrorlist = nil
|
||||
return remote
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// shouldFailover reports whether an upstream attempt error is worth retrying
|
||||
// against the next mirror: network errors/timeouts and upstream 5xx responses.
|
||||
// Definitive statuses (404/403/401/...) are returned to the caller unchanged.
|
||||
func shouldFailover(err error) bool {
|
||||
if isNetworkError(err) {
|
||||
return true
|
||||
}
|
||||
var pe *ProxyError
|
||||
if errors.As(err, &pe) {
|
||||
return pe.Status >= 500
|
||||
}
|
||||
return false
|
||||
}

// mirrorlistPackageTypes are the package types for which a mirrorlist is
|
||||
// allowed: OS package repos (rpm, deb, apk/alpine) that fetch many small files
|
||||
// and benefit most from mirror load-balancing and failover.
|
||||
var mirrorlistPackageTypes = map[PackageType]bool{
|
||||
PackageRPM: true,
|
||||
PackageDeb: true,
|
||||
PackageAlpine: true,
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// UpstreamPool returns the ordered upstream base URLs for this remote: the
|
||||
// primary base_url first, followed by any mirrorlist entries. The proxy engine
|
||||
// load-balances round-robin across the pool and fails over between them.
|
||||
func (r Remote) UpstreamPool() []string {
|
||||
pool := make([]string, 0, 1+len(r.Mirrorlist))
|
||||
if r.BaseURL != "" {
|
||||
pool = append(pool, r.BaseURL)
|
||||
}
|
||||
pool = append(pool, r.Mirrorlist...)
|
||||
return pool
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// ValidateMirrorlist enforces that a mirrorlist is only configured on remote
|
||||
// rpm/deb/apk repositories and that every entry is a parseable http/https URL.
|
||||
func (r *Remote) ValidateMirrorlist() error {
|
||||
if len(r.Mirrorlist) == 0 {
|
||||
return nil
|
||||
}
|
||||
if r.RepoType != RepoTypeRemote {
|
||||
return fmt.Errorf("mirrorlist is only allowed on remote repositories")
|
||||
}
|
||||
if !mirrorlistPackageTypes[r.PackageType] {
|
||||
return fmt.Errorf("mirrorlist is only allowed for rpm, deb and alpine package types, not %q", r.PackageType)
|
||||
}
|
||||
for _, u := range r.Mirrorlist {
|
||||
parsed, err := url.ParseRequestURI(u)
|
||||
if err != nil {
|
||||
return fmt.Errorf("invalid mirrorlist url %q: %w", u, err)
|
||||
}
|
||||
if parsed.Scheme != "http" && parsed.Scheme != "https" {
|
||||
return fmt.Errorf("mirrorlist url %q must be http or https", u)
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
return nil
|
||||
}
